I need a database driven programme (maybe even using MS Access to store the data) to record operating notes.
The database should be able to reside on a central server, but allow the interface for data input to be opened on a number of computers on the intranet network at the same time.
There should be a use name/password for each individual needing to access the database and enter data (but not delete), and a master administrator username/password which will allow addition of more users, as well as editing/deleting of data.
The database should also record date/time/person who modified or made an entry.
The database will have the following fields:
1. Patient - first name(Free text box)
2. Patient - surname(Free text box)
3. Patient hospital number(Free text box)
4. Patient dob (date input in DD/MM/YYYY format)
5. Sex of patient - male/female (radio button)
6. Date of operation (date input in DD/MM/YYYY format)
7. Commencement time of operation (there should be a START button on the interface which will allow one to press it, and it automatically capture the date/time from the computer clock)
8. Finish time of operation (Same as above, but for finish time)
9. Name of operation(s) (can be drop down box with user selectable list) – this should then generate:
a) in one box, the automatic operation record with list of postoperative nursing instructions including follow-up arrangements which is then amended by surgeon as required within the box.
b) in another box, an automatic automatic GP discharge letter including follow-up arrangements which is then amended by surgeon as required
c) in a third box, an automatic list of medications to take home which is then amended by surgeon as required
** For (a), (b), and (c) - the text can be automatically obtained from a modifiable set of files ?txt/.doc or something similar.
10. Code(s) for operation(s) (free text box)
11. Right/left/bilateral (radio button)
12. Preop diagnosis (diagnoses) (free text box)
13. GA/LA/LA sedate (radio button)
14. Surgeon names (Free text box)
15. Assistant names (Free text box)
16. Scrub nurse names (Free text box)
17. Name of consultant patient registered under (Free text box)
18. Operating theatre number (Free text box)
19. Complication(s) Yes/No (radio button)
20. Free text entry for complication (if yes selected above).
-----
The database must be updatable, mainly the source files for some of the text as mentioned above for (a), (b), (c), as well as user list and administrator list. It should allow searches in future on the source file for operations with complications / all of a particular operation type / all operations with complications, etc, easily.
